> > # ipnat -l
> > List of active MAP/Redirect filters:
> > map ppp0 198.168.1.0/24 -> 0.0.0.0/32 proxy port ftp ftp/tcp
> > map ppp0 198.168.1.0/24 -> 0.0.0.0/32 portmap tcp/udp 10000:40000
> > map ppp0 198.168.1.0/24 -> 0.0.0.0/32
Ah! It's always the simple things that trip me up.
The problem was that my local net work address is 192.168...
not 198.168...
Now it works just like it's advertised.
